Skills and Experience Required for Drainage Technician Jobs London

Employers recruiting for drainage technician jobs in London typically require:

  • Experience installing and maintaining drainage and sewer systems

  • Knowledge of underground pipework, stormwater systems, and wastewater management

  • Understanding of UK construction and environmental regulations

  • Ability to read site drawings and infrastructure plans

  • Strong awareness of health and safety practices on civil engineering sites

Drainage technicians frequently collaborate with civil engineers, road construction engineers, site supervisors, and project managers to ensure drainage systems integrate effectively with road infrastructure and property developments.
